Job Description:

We are seeking a dedicated and detail-oriented School Administrator to join our vibrant school community ASAP in St. Helens. As the first point of contact for parents and visitors, you will play a vital role in the smooth running of our daily operations. From managing student data to supporting the senior leadership team, your efficiency will help create a positive environment for our students to thrive.

Job Responsibility:

  • Maintaining accurate student records using SIMS
  • Managing the school's front-of-house, welcoming visitors, and handling inquiries
  • Assisting with attendance monitoring and reporting
  • General clerical duties including filing, mailing, and coordinating school communications

Requirements:

  • Previous experience working in a school office is essential
  • Proficiency in SIMS (School Information Management System) is highly desirable
  • Excellent communication skills and a friendly, professional manner
